Description

This immaculate terraced property in a sought-after location is now available for sale with no onward chain, making it an ideal opportunity for couples and first-time buyers. The house comprises of a beautifully refurbished open-plan kitchen, perfect for modern living, a cosy reception room with a fireplace, and a renovated bathroom.

The property boasts two double bedrooms, with the first bedroom benefiting from built-in wardrobes. Both bedrooms offer a comfortable and inviting space for relaxation.

One of the unique features of this home is the charming fireplace in the reception room, adding character and warmth to the living space. Additionally, the property includes a delightful garden, providing a tranquil outdoor area for relaxation or entertaining guests.

Situated in a convenient location with excellent public transport links, local amenities, and walking routes nearby, this property offers both comfort and convenience for its future owners. Don’t miss the opportunity to make this beautifully presented house your new home.


The accommodation:


Entrance:
Glass composite door, under stairs storage and radiator.


Lounge: 13’9’’ 4.19m x 10’11’’ 3.33m into alcove
UPVC window, open fire with surround and radiator.


Kitchen Diner: 14’10’’ 4.52m plus alcove x 9’10’’ 2.99m
Composite stable door, UPVC window, fitted with a range of matching wall and base units with work surfaces above incorporating sink and drainer, integrated gas hob, electric oven, washing machine and fridge freezer, Inglenook fireplace, storage and radiator.


First Floor Landing:
Loft access.


Bedroom One: 13’7’’ 4.15m x 12’0’’ 3.66m
UPVC window, fireplace, working open fire, two storage cupboards, solid wood flooring and radiator.


Bedroom Two: 12’0’’ 3.66m x 10’5’’ 3.18m
UPVC window, solid wood flooring and radiator.


Bathroom:
UPVC window, bath with shower, low level wc, vanity wash hand basin, part tiled and radiator.


Externally:
There is a west facing lawned garden to the front with a patio area. To the rear there is a yard with potential for off street parking.
